Mae West
On The Chase & Sanborn Hour

Album US 1981 on Radiola label
Spoken Word, Pop and Soundtrack (Radioplay, Comedy, Spoken Word)

The complete NBC Red Network Radio Broadcast of December 12, 1937. Sponsored by Chase and Sanborn Coffee. "The classic "Adam and Eve" broadcast that got Mae West banned from network radio!". Release No. 126.
